基于低分子神经激素促肾上腺皮质激素释放因子(CRF)的免疫调节作用,我们观察了CRF对正常人外周血单个核细胞产生IL-1和IL-2活性的影响。IL-1和IL-2的产生被纳摩尔浓度的CRF本身所刺激。此外,CRF还能增加脂多糖诱导的IL-1的产生和植物血凝素诱导的IL-2的产生。这些结果表明,CRF可能通过作为神经内分泌-免疫通路的血液媒介来调节免疫系统细胞的功能。
Based upon an immunomodulatory role for Corticotropin-Releasing Factor (CRF), a low molecular weight neurohormone, we investigated the effect of CRF on the production of interleukin-1 (IL-1) and interleukin-2 (IL-2) activities of mononuclear cells isolated from the peripheral blood of healthy subjects. The production of both IL-1 and IL-2 was stimulated by a nanomolar concentration of CRF by itself. In addition, CRF augmented the production of IL-1 as induced by lipopolysaccharide and the production of IL-2 as induced by phytohemagglutinin. These results suggest that CRF modulates the function of the cells of the immune system presumably by acting as a blood-borne mediator of the neuroendocrine-immune pathways.
